Aggressively capturing first place overall at the conclusion of the 1983-84 NHL season while suffering only 18 loses, the Edmonton Oilers were led by The Great One’s ridiculous 205 points. Dispatching of Vancouver, Calgary and Minnesota in the postseason, the Oilers would meet and defeat the Islanders in the Stanley Cup final for the franchise’s first championship. Celebrating the 1984 Stanley Cup-champion Oilers, we have a limited-edition canvas team-signed by the club. Originating from the 30th anniversary of the victory, this canvas was signed at the reunion party in the spring of 2015. At 20” x 24” and numbered “#5 of 8”, the stretched canvas features a team photo above, with 33 signatures placed beneath, including Gretzky, Messier, Coffey, Kurri, Fuhr, Anderson, Moog, Lowe, Semenko, Huddy, Sather, Pocklington and many others, with the blue marker signatures displaying beautifully. There is a bit of wear to the canvas, with a hologram from the Oilers attached to the reverse, with a team LOA to accompany.
